Wilson Middle School held an assembly to bring awareness to suicide. The speaker was a boy named Foster’s dad, and it was very sad. To begin, the Wilson Choir sang a song from Dear Evan Hansen the broadway show. Foster’s dad explained that his son was very popular and everyone liked him, but things kept piling up and it became too much for him. Foster ended up taking his own life. Foster’s dad explained that everyone matters in the world and to get help if you need it. Getting help isn’t a sign of weakness, it is a sign of strength. At the end of the assembly, everyone got a bracelet that says “Foster’s Voice Suicide Awareness.”
